Understanding First Communion Traditions
First Communion is a Catholic sacrament that celebrates the child’s first reception of the Eucharist, which is the body and blood of Jesus Christ. It usually takes place when the child is around seven or eight years old, and it’s a joyful and solemn occasion that involves attending Mass, receiving blessings and gifts, and spending time with family and friends. To honor this special day, many families choose to dress up their children in formal attire, including suits, dresses, veils, and accessories.

Considering Hair Length and Type
When choosing a hairstyle for First Communion, you’ll want to consider your child’s hair length and type. If your child has long hair, you’ll have more options for hairstyles. You can choose from updos, braids, curls, or half-up, half-down styles. If your child has short hair, you can still create a beautiful hairstyle with accessories like headbands or hair clips.
If your child has curly hair, you can embrace their natural texture and create a beautiful curly hairstyle. You can also straighten their hair if they prefer a sleeker look. If your child has bangs, you’ll need to consider how to incorporate them into the hairstyle. You can pin them back or leave them down, depending on the style you choose.
Matching Hairstyle with Personal Style and Face Shape
When choosing a hairstyle for First Communion, it’s important to consider your child’s personal style and face shape. You want to choose a hairstyle that complements their features and makes them feel confident.
If your child has a round face shape, you can create height at the crown to elongate the face. If your child has a square face shape, you can soften the angles with curls or waves. If your child has an oval face shape, they can wear almost any hairstyle.
You’ll also want to consider your child’s personal style. If they prefer a classic look, you can choose a simple updo or half-up, half-down style. If they prefer a more bohemian look, you can add braids or floral accessories to their hairstyle.

Selecting the Perfect Headpiece
When it comes to headpieces, there are many options to choose from. A tiara is a classic choice that adds a touch of elegance to any hairstyle. A flower crown is a popular option for a more bohemian or natural look. Headbands can be simple or elaborate, and can be adorned with pearls, rhinestones, or other embellishments.
When selecting a headpiece, it’s important to consider the style of the dress and the hairstyle. A simple headband may be all that’s needed for a classic dress and hairstyle, while a more elaborate headpiece may be appropriate for a more formal dress and hairstyle.
Incorporating Flowers and Ribbons
Flowers and ribbons are a popular way to add a feminine touch to a First Communion hairstyle. A flower headband can be made with fresh or silk flowers, and can be customized to match the colors of the dress. A simple white ribbon can be tied around a bun or ponytail for a classic look.
When incorporating flowers and ribbons, it’s important to consider the size and placement. A large flower crown may overwhelm a small child’s face, while a small flower clip may get lost in a larger hairstyle. A ribbon tied in a bow at the back of the head can add a touch of sweetness to the hairstyle.

Creating a Durable Hairstyle
As a hairstylist, I know that creating a durable hairstyle is crucial for special events like First Communion. The last thing you want is for the hairstyle to fall apart halfway through the ceremony. To ensure that the hairstyle stays in place, I recommend using bobby pins and hair clips. These tools are essential for creating a strong foundation for the hairstyle.
Another important tip is to use hairspray and hair gel. Hairspray helps to keep the hairstyle in place, while hair gel adds texture and volume. When using hairspray, it’s important to hold the can at least 12 inches away from the hair to avoid a sticky buildup. For hair gel, a small amount goes a long way.
Using the Right Hair Products
Choosing the right hair product is essential for creating a beautiful hairstyle that lasts all day. When selecting hair products, it’s important to consider the hair type and texture. For example, if the hair is fine and limp, a volumizing mousse can help to add body and texture. On the other hand, if the hair is thick and curly, a smoothing serum can help to tame frizz and define curls.

Washing and Conditioning
It is essential to wash and condition your child’s hair before styling it for First Communion. I recommend using a gentle shampoo and conditioner that is suitable for your child’s hair type. If your child has dry or damaged hair, you may want to consider using a deep conditioning treatment a few days before the event.
When washing your child’s hair, be sure to rinse it thoroughly to avoid any residue that may make the hair look dull or greasy. Also, avoid using hot water, as it can damage the hair and make it difficult to style.
Pre-Communion Hair Trial
Before the big day, it is a good idea to do a trial run of your child’s hair. This will give you an idea of how long it takes to style the hair and whether any adjustments need to be made. It will also give your child a chance to get used to the hairstyle and make any necessary changes.
During the trial, you can experiment with different hairstyles and accessories to find the perfect look for your child. This will also give you a chance to see how the hair holds up over time and make any necessary adjustments.

Can you suggest some elegant bun styles for a First Communion?
Buns are a classic and elegant choice for First Communion hairstyles. A low bun at the nape of the neck can look sophisticated, while a high bun can add a touch of playfulness. You can also try a braided bun or a twisted bun for added texture and interest. Be sure to secure the bun with bobby pins and hairspray for a long-lasting hold.
